Nino's Italian Restaurant is located at 2968 Pelham Parkway in Pelham. The restaurant, owned by Walter Caron and sportscaster Eli Gold, opened in 2009.

The restaurant is named for Caron's uncle Nino Reale of New York. Caron and Gold became friends around 2003 when Gold and his wife frequented Salvatore's in Vestavia Hills where Caron was the manager. Both are native New Yorkers. They decided to open the restaurant in Pelham because there were no Italian restaurants in the area.

After Caron died in February 2019 his family continued to operate the restaurant.
